Server does not boot

I have closed all the threads and opening a new one..

This is new Installation:-
There is no data apart from vg00:-

I have installend 11.31 on external disk
I have 11.23 on internal disk

Now I wanted to mirrior the external disk to the Internal...

I have done the below:-

# idisk -f /tmp/idf -w /dev/rdisk/disk6

# idisk -f /tmp/idf -w /dev/rdisk/disk8

#pvcreate -B /dev/rdisk/disk6_p2

#vgextend vg00 /dev/disk/disk6_p2

this gave an error

Couldn't open physical volume "/dev/rdisk/disk9_p2":
Verification of unique LVM disk id on each disk in the volume group
vg00 failed.

Then I rebooted the server... now it does not boot up...

now either I havee to bring the server up & running or

reinstall the oS... but to reinstall I do not have fs0 or fs1 or fs2... plz advise

Re: Server does not boot

putting an install DVD into the DVD on the server, and rebooting to the EFI prompt, interrupt that and it should shows a fs(x) as the DVD rom
Read the manuals, all explained in there.

Re: Server does not boot

yes, because it appears that you have corrupted the origional boot disks.
Start with the DVD and do a clean install.
Then read the manual pages on mirroring an Integrity server boot disk.
